A very daring and brave (see dress!) Isla accompanied her husband to the London premiere of his hotly anticipated new movie Les Miserables last night! Isla wore a strapless, cut-out white dress by Aussie designer Willow, accessorising her look with a silver necklace and bracelet, and silver strappy heels. Her chivalrous husband covered her up with a black blazer when the cold got too much! While I’m not 100% in love with this dress yet, I do like seeing her take such a red carpet risk. And more than that, I love seeing her and Sacha on the red carpet together again! ♥
